Ahead of her meeting with European leaders in Brussels, British Prime Minister Theresa May told reporters that they sincerely hoped to leave with a negotiated deal and argued that a short extension to Article 50 would give them this opportunity.
Key quotes (via Reuters)
- I am here to discuss with fellow leaders a request for short extension to June.
- Britain will continue to be in discussions on issues like China, Ukraine.
- What is important is that parliament deliver on result in referendum.
- Now is time for parliament to decide.
